Winston-Salem State University, a historically Black institution, has addressed the use of law enforcement on its campus after a viral video captured a student being arrested in a classroom after an apparent dispute with a professor
The incident began with what “appears to be a disagreement over a class assignment,” Haley Gingles, spokesperson for the university, told CNN. The student and the professor were not identified by Winston-Salem State, which is an HBCU, shorthand for historically Black colleges and universities. In the video, two police officers can be seen handcuffing the student, who is Black, as other students film the arrest and express shock at what is happening.
” The university’s chancellor, Elwood Robinson, released a letter to address the arrest. “We understand that the weaponization of police is a prevalent problem in our community; however, that is not what happened in this incident,” Robinson wrote. “We know this situation has caused a great deal of trauma to those involved and our campus community at large, but please know that every available resource is being extended to bring a resolution,” he continued.
